Title: Innovations by Jin Chae in Semiconductor Wafer Handling

Introduction

Jin Chae is an accomplished inventor based in Santa Clara, CA, specializing in semiconductor technology. He has made significant contributions to the field with a total of two patents to his name. His work focuses on improving the efficiency and safety of semiconductor wafer handling, transport, and storage.

Latest Patents

Jin Chae's latest patents include innovative designs for separators used in the handling, transporting, or storing of semiconductor wafers. These separators are configured to carry semiconductor wafers with enhanced efficiency, protection, and reduced costs. The design features a circular ring with an outer edge defining its periphery and an inner edge that creates a central opening. Additionally, the separator includes a first right-angled recess for receiving a semiconductor wafer, which extends downward from the top surface of the circular ring. A second right-angled recess is also incorporated to maintain a gap beneath the semiconductor wafer when it is set within the first recess. In some embodiments, interlock components are included to connect the wafer separator to adjacent separators, further enhancing its functionality.
